The job

Here’s what the job entails
Your primary function will be to develop risk measures and valuation models, including data analysis and model development. You will gain valuable experience in modelling energy markets and learn how these models enable best in class risk management.

Your areas of responsibility will include the following:

  • perform ad hoc analyses to support new business cases
  • develop quantitative analyses together with your colleagues in Risk Management
  • improve and work with the team’s quantitative model library
  • conduct model validation and back testing to ensure our models meet the highest standards

The team

Meet the team
You will join our Risk Modelling team, which works with valuation of all products in the company and modelling exposures to a spectrum of risk factors. The role of the team is to support the Market Risk Management team in controlling and managing the wide range of risks in our global portfolio. To ensure proper risk management, we have the responsibility to keep our models up to date with market developments and to support the Risk Control team in analysing significant changes in the daily reports.

We are a team of five skilled specialists within quantitative risk modelling. We are collaborative by nature, and we believe that no task is impossible if we put our collective minds to it. We are curious and motivated by improving our solutions, and we are not afraid of making mistakes – as long as we learn from them.

You will get the opportunity to design and implement mathematical models for proactive risk management of a portfolio of complex products in some of the most interesting markets in the world.

Your qualifications

But enough about us… over to you!
As you will be working with a complex domain, we are looking for an innovative colleague who likes taking responsibility. You will drive your own projects, and we see you as someone who always take an interest in moving the team forward and helping where needed. As data analysis and model validation are a big part of your role, we also picture you as both analytical and curious.

We also imagine that you:

  • have an education in mathematics, economics, finance or similar (or is about to graduate this summer)
  • have experience with Python, .NET, SQL or similar – or are keen to learn
  • are curious and interested in learning about the energy markets
  • are proficient in English – both written and verbal

Please note that it is not a requirement to have prior knowledge of the energy industry to enter this role.
